What Is a 9000 BTU Mini Split?


A 9000 BTU mini split is a ductless heating and cooling system designed for smaller rooms or spaces. BTU (British Thermal Unit) is the measurement of how much heating or cooling the unit can handle. The higher the BTU, the larger the area it can condition.


What Room Size Is Perfect for 9000 BTU


A 9000 BTU mini split is typically ideal for:

  • Rooms between 350–450 square feet

  • Bedrooms, small living rooms, offices, or dens

  • Well-insulated spaces with average ceiling height (8 ft)

Room Size

Square Footage

Recommended BTU

Small bedroom

150–250 sq ft

5000–6000 BTU

Medium bedroom/office

250–350 sq ft

7000–8000 BTU

Large bedroom/small living area

350–450 sq ft

9000 BTU

Oversized room/open plan

450–600 sq ft

12000+ BTU


Factors That Affect Sizing


  • Insulation quality — Poor insulation requires more BTUs.

  • Ceiling height — Higher ceilings increase volume, needing more cooling power.

  • Sun exposure — South or west-facing rooms heat up faster.

  • Occupancy — More people generate more heat.

  • Appliances — Electronics and lighting add to cooling demand.

Always oversize slightly if your space gets lots of sunlight or has poor insulation.

DIY Mini Split Installation Basics


  1. Choose the Wall Location — Mount indoor unit high on the wall with clear airflow.

  2. Install the Outdoor Condenser — Place on stable, level pad with good clearance.

  3. Drill Line Set Hole — Run refrigerant, power, and drain lines between indoor and outdoor units.

  4. Connect Line Set & Drain — Ensure tight, sealed connections for refrigerant and condensate.

  5. Vacuum & Charge the System — Essential to remove air/moisture before releasing refrigerant.

  6. Power & Test Run — Connect electrical supply, check settings, and test heating/cooling modes.

FAQ


What size room does a 9000 BTU mini split cover? Around 350–450 sq ft in average conditions.


Can I install a 9000 BTU mini split myself? Yes, if you’re comfortable with drilling, electrical work, and line connections.


What happens if a mini split is undersized? It will run constantly, struggle to cool or heat, and wear out faster.


What if it’s oversized? It will short cycle, waste energy, and not control humidity well.


Do I need a professional for the refrigerant lines? Often yes — many DIY kits are pre-charged, but professional vacuum and charging gives the best results.
